Free Little Rock event letting families experience unique vehicles

Little Rock, Arkansas – Families will have the opportunity to explore specialty vehicles at the Family Touch-a-Truck event, a free event at Little Rock’s Park Plaza Mall.
According to a representative, the event will take place on Saturday in the southwest parking lot of the mall from 11 a.m. to 3 p.m.
The mall cited the numerous vehicles, which included police cars, ambulances, fire trucks, and other types of vehicles.
The Little Rock Police Department, Little Rock Fire Department, MEMS, Arkansas Game and Fish, Pulaski County Sheriff’s Office, Saia LTL Freight, Waste Management, American Red Cross Arkansas, Greenway Equipment, Coca-Cola, and Dippin’ Dots are among the organizations taking part and donating vehicles.
According to officials, if it rains, the event will move to the parking garage’s lower level.
